Answer:
60 miles per hour
Step-by-step explanation:
Let x represent Justin's speed in the morning.
We have been given that one morning Justin drove 3 hours before stopping to eat lunch at Chick-fil-A.
[tex]\text{Distance}=\text{Speed}\times \text{Time}[/tex]
Distance covered by Justin in 3 hours would be [tex]3x[/tex].
After lunch, he increased his speed by 10 mph; so his new speed would be [tex]x+10[/tex].
We are also told that he traveled 530-mile trip in 8 hours. The time he drove after lunch would be [tex]8-3=5\text{ hours}[/tex].
Distance covered by Justin in 5 hours after lunch would be [tex]5(x+10)[/tex].
Now, we will equate distance traveled before and after lunch to solve for x as:
[tex]3x+5(x+10)=530[/tex]
[tex]3x+5x+50=530[/tex]
[tex]8x+50=530[/tex]
[tex]8x+50-50=530-50[/tex]
[tex]8x=480[/tex]
[tex]\frac{8x}{8}=\frac{480}{8}[/tex]
[tex]x=60[/tex]
Therefore, Justin drove at a speed of 60 miles per hour in the morning.
